YomoMedia is a free rich media RSS reader application for Windows Mobile devices. It automatically retrieves any RSS feed, audio or video podcast and stores the content on the device enabling offline viewing and listening. With YomoMedia, feeds are updated as often as every 5 minutes or once a day.
You don''t have to worry about intermittent network connections because the content is saved on your phone, ready for you to view or listen to at any time. Use the YomoMedia web application to discover new feeds and view and manage your subscriptions. You can also create Bundles of feeds to share with others.

Supported operating systems:
Windows Mobile 5.0, Windows Mobile 5.0 Smartphone, Windows Mobile 6 Classic, Windows Mobile 6 Professional, Windows Mobile 6 Standard, Windows Mobile 6.1 Classic, Windows Mobile 6.1 Professional, Windows Mobile 6.1 Standard, Windows Mobile 6.5 Professional, Windows Mobile 6.5 Standard
